Implementing a Secure Payment System for Casino Scripts

Implementing a Secure Payment System for Casino Scripts

Selecting the right payment gateway is crucial for building a robust and trustworthy secure payment system for your casino scripts. The gateway you choose will be the backbone of your online payments infrastructure, directly impacting the user experience and the overall security of your payment processing. Consider factors such as transaction fees, supported payment methods (credit cards, e-wallets, cryptocurrencies), and the gateway’s geographic reach. A reputable gateway with a proven track record in handling high-volume transactions is vital. Look for features like fraud detection and prevention tools to minimize risks associated with fraudulent activities. The gateway should also offer robust encryption and secure data handling protocols to ensure the confidentiality and integrity of sensitive financial data. Furthermore, consider the level of integration support offered by the gateway; seamless integration with your existing casino scripts is essential for a smooth and efficient user experience. Investigate the gateway’s security certifications and compliance with industry standards like PCI DSS to guarantee payment security and reassure your users. Choosing a gateway that fully supports your target audience’s preferred payment methods is essential for maximizing conversion rates.

Integrating Security Protocols

Implementing robust security protocols is paramount for any casino script’s secure payment system. This goes beyond simply choosing a secure payment gateway; it requires a multi-layered approach encompassing various security measures. First, HTTPS should be enforced across your entire website, ensuring all communication between the user’s browser and your servers is encrypted. This prevents eavesdropping and man-in-the-middle attacks during online payments. Regular security audits and penetration testing should be conducted to identify vulnerabilities proactively. This includes simulating attack scenarios to uncover weaknesses before malicious actors can exploit them. Implementing strong input validation across all forms handling financial data is crucial; this prevents SQL injection attacks and other vulnerabilities that might compromise payment processing. Utilize strong password policies for all user accounts, encouraging strong, unique passwords and implementing multi-factor authentication (MFA) wherever possible, significantly enhancing payment security.

Data encryption at rest and in transit is another critical component. All sensitive data, including payment information, should be encrypted both when stored in databases and when transmitted over the network. Employing industry-standard encryption algorithms like AES-256 is essential. Regularly update all software and libraries used in your casino scripts and payment processing systems to patch known vulnerabilities. Out-of-date software represents a significant security risk, leaving your system open to exploits. Consider implementing a Web Application Firewall (WAF) to filter malicious traffic and prevent common web attacks such as cross-site scripting (XSS) and cross-site request forgery (CSRF) that could compromise your secure payment system. Finally, regular security training for your development and operations teams is crucial to ensure everyone understands and adheres to best security practices. The goal is a proactively secure system designed to mitigate risk at every level of the payment processing pipeline, providing your users with confidence in the security of their transactions within your casino scripts.

Handling Sensitive Data

Implementing a Secure Payment System for Casino Scripts

Protecting sensitive data is paramount in a secure payment system for casino scripts. The entire payment processing pipeline, from data entry to storage and transmission, must adhere to strict security protocols. Begin by minimizing the collection of sensitive data. Only collect the information absolutely necessary for processing online payments; avoid storing unnecessary details. Implement tokenization to replace actual credit card numbers and other sensitive data with non-sensitive substitutes, reducing the risk of data breaches. For any data that must be stored, use robust encryption both at rest and in transit, employing strong algorithms like AES-256. All databases holding sensitive information should be regularly backed up and secured against unauthorized access, with strict access control lists enforced.

Regular security audits and penetration testing are crucial to identify vulnerabilities in your data handling practices. This proactive approach to security helps pinpoint weaknesses before they can be exploited. Compliance with relevant data privacy regulations, such as GDPR and CCPA, is also essential. Understanding these regulations and implementing the appropriate measures to ensure compliance is non-negotiable for maintaining payment security and building trust with your users. Employee training on data security best practices should be ongoing, covering topics like phishing prevention, secure password management, and the responsible handling of sensitive customer information. This collective understanding of data security is crucial for maintaining a robust secure payment system.

Consider using a dedicated, secure vault for sensitive data, isolated from other systems to further limit access and enhance protection. This level of segregation significantly reduces the impact of a potential breach. Continuously monitor your systems for any suspicious activities using intrusion detection systems or security information and event management (SIEM) tools. Promptly address any detected anomalies to minimize the potential for data compromise. In short, a multi-layered strategy, combining technological safeguards with rigorous security practices and employee training, is the foundation of a secure payment system that safeguards your users’ sensitive data and protects your casino scripts’ reputation.

Meeting Regulatory Compliance

Adherence to relevant regulations is paramount for establishing a trustworthy and legally compliant secure payment system for your casino scripts. The specific regulations will vary depending on your location and the types of online payments you process. However, some key regulations to consider include the Payment Card Industry Data Security Standard (PCI DSS), which dictates security requirements for handling credit card information. Understanding and implementing the stringent security controls mandated by PCI DSS is crucial for preventing data breaches and maintaining payment security. Failure to comply can result in significant financial penalties and reputational damage.

Beyond PCI DSS, you must also consider regional and national regulations related to data privacy and online gambling. Regulations like the General Data Protection Regulation (GDPR) in Europe and the California Consumer Privacy Act (CCPA) in the United States impose strict rules on how you collect, store, and process personal data, including financial information. Compliance requires implementing measures such as data minimization, informed consent, and data breach notification protocols. It’s vital to consult with legal experts specializing in online gambling and data privacy to ensure your casino scripts and payment processing systems are fully compliant with all the applicable laws and regulations in your jurisdiction.

Regular audits and assessments of your secure payment system are essential to demonstrate ongoing compliance. These audits should evaluate your adherence to the relevant standards and identify any areas needing improvement. You should document all your compliance efforts, including security policies, procedures, and training records, to produce auditable evidence of compliance. Maintaining comprehensive and readily-available documentation will significantly aid in any compliance assessments. Proactive compliance is not just about avoiding penalties; it also builds trust with your customers, reassuring them that their payments are handled securely and responsibly, enhancing the reputation of your casino scripts and your overall business.

Testing and Monitoring

Implementing a Secure Payment System for Casino Scripts

Thorough testing and ongoing monitoring are indispensable for maintaining a robust and secure payment system within your casino scripts. This involves a multifaceted approach combining automated checks with manual reviews to ensure the reliable and secure operation of your online payments infrastructure. Before launching your system, conduct extensive testing, including unit testing of individual components, integration testing to verify interactions between different parts, and ultimately, user acceptance testing (UAT) with real users to simulate real-world payment scenarios.

Automated monitoring tools should continuously track key performance indicators (KPIs) and security metrics related to your payment processing. This includes monitoring transaction success rates, average processing times, and error rates. Real-time alerts should be configured to notify your team immediately of any significant anomalies or security events, such as unusual transaction volumes or suspected fraudulent activities. These alerts allow for quick responses to potential threats, minimizing downtime and preventing financial losses. Regular security scans and vulnerability assessments are essential for proactively identifying security weaknesses within your system. Penetration testing, simulating real-world attack scenarios, is also recommended to evaluate the system’s resilience to cyber threats. The goal is to identify and address vulnerabilities before malicious actors can exploit them, enhancing the overall payment security of your casino scripts.

Careful logging of all payment transactions and related events is crucial for auditing and investigation purposes. These logs should contain detailed information about each transaction, including timestamps, transaction amounts, user data, and processing statuses. Regularly review and analyze these logs to identify potential security breaches or performance bottlenecks. Your system should also include robust mechanisms for handling payment disputes and chargebacks. Clear processes and documented procedures are necessary for addressing these issues efficiently and fairly, minimizing potential financial impacts to your business. Finally, consider implementing a comprehensive disaster recovery plan to address potential outages or data loss. This plan should detail strategies for restoring your payment processing system quickly and minimizing service disruption. Payment security requires an ongoing commitment to testing, monitoring and proactive mitigation of potential issues, ensuring the smooth and secure operation of your casino scripts’ online payments.

Leave a Reply

Your email address will not be published. Required fields are marked *